One such solution that is gaining popularity is the real time parking system.
A real time parking system utilizes technology to provide up-to-the-minute information on available parking spaces in a given area. These systems use a variety of sensors, cameras, and software to monitor parking spots and relay that information to drivers in real time. By leveraging data and connectivity, real time parking systems aim to streamline the parking process and optimize the use of existing parking facilities.
One of the key benefits of a real time parking system is the ability to reduce the time and stress associated with finding parking. Drivers can access information on available spaces through a mobile app or website, allowing them to plan their parking ahead of time and avoid aimlessly circling around the block. This not only saves time for the driver, but also reduces fuel consumption and emissions from idling vehicles.
real time parking systems also have the potential to increase the efficiency of parking facilities. By providing accurate data on parking availability, these systems can help drivers make informed decisions on where to park, thus reducing congestion in popular areas and distributing vehicles more evenly across different zones. This can lead to improved traffic flow and a more organized parking experience for all users.
Furthermore, real time parking systems can be a valuable tool for city planners and parking operators. By analyzing data collected from the system, they can gain insights into parking patterns, occupancy rates, and peak hours of demand. This information can be used to optimize parking facility management, inform pricing strategies, and make more informed decisions on future infrastructure development. Ultimately, real time parking systems can help cities make better use of their parking resources and create a more sustainable urban environment.
In addition to improving the parking experience for drivers and optimizing parking operations, real time parking systems can also have a positive impact on the environment. By reducing the time spent searching for parking and the associated emissions, these systems can help lower overall carbon footprint and contribute to cleaner air in urban areas. This is especially important in cities where air quality is a major concern and transportation-related emissions are a significant contributor to pollution.
